Abstract
The invention relates to a film for wrapping, in particular to a precoated film with an atomization-preventing function which is characterized by consisting of a secondary functional layer, a core layer and a coated functional layer; the core layer is positioned between the secondary functional layer and the coated functional layer; the material of the secondary functional layer consists of polypropylene and an antifogging agent; the addition amount of the antifogging agent is 0.1-3% of the mass of the polypropylene; the material of the core layer is modified polyethylene; the material of the coated functional layer is a binding agent; and the secondary functional layer, the core layer and the coated functional layer are thermally synthesized into a whole. The precoated film with the atomization-preventing function has the characteristics of antifogging function, convenience and simpleness in use.

Background technology
Transparent plastic sheeting is in wet environment, when humidity reaches dew point when following; Can be at the trickle water droplet of its surface condensation one deck; Make the surface blur atomizing, hindered seeing through of light wave, when for example utilizing the blister-pack product; Also can cannot see content, and the droplet that produces also causes the rotten damage of content easily because of the knot mist.
Film is compounded on wrapping paper or the plastics, is employed in coating viscosity glue on paper or the plastics usually, then heating, mucous membrane.Exist complex process, high, the high deficiency of production cost of production equipment requirement.Simultaneously, the layer of structure of the film that current packaging is used is more, complex structure, and do not possess anti-fog function.

The specific embodiment
Pre-coating film as shown in Figure 1, as to have the preventing atomization function, it is made up of subfunction layer 1, sandwich layer 2, coating functional layer 3, and sandwich layer 2 is between subfunction layer 1 and coating functional layer 3; The material of subfunction layer 1 is served as reasons and is comprised polypropylene (PP) and antifoggant composition, and the addition of antifoggant is 0.1~3% of a polypropylene quality; The material of sandwich layer 2 is modified poly ethylene (PE), and the material of coating functional layer 3 is a bonding agent; Subfunction layer 1, sandwich layer 2, coating functional layer 3 thermal synthesis one (send into extrude compounding machine extrude the thermal synthesis one, 85~120 ℃ of heat-seal temperatures).
The effect of subfunction layer 1 is the outward appearance of film and antifog, through in polypropylene, adding additive (be incorporated as 0~3% of polypropylene quality, concrete additive determines with the need, as: add pigment of all kinds), can change the outward appearance of film, as transparent or opaque; The subfunction layer also has antiseized effect.
The effect of sandwich layer 2 is as carrier.
The effect of coating functional layer 3 is and wrapping paper or plastic bonding 85~120 ℃ of heat-seal temperatures.
Described bonding agent is modified EVA bonding agent (a modified EVA emulsion binding agent).
Antifoggant is exactly to prevent to tie the mist phenomenon and the analog assistant that uses; They are some surfactants that have hydrophilic group; Can be orientated at frosting, hydrophobic group is inside, and hydrophilic group is outside; Thereby make water be easy to moistening frosting, water layer or large water drop that the fine water droplet that condenses can diffuse to form rapidly as thin as a wafer get off along Film Flow.So just can avoid the atomizing that light scattering caused of droplet, prevent that the water droplet that condenses is unrestrained above packed article, the infringement packed article.
The chemical composition of antifoggant mainly is the partial esterification thing of aliphatic acid and polyalcohol.Polyalcohol commonly used is glycerine (glycerin mono-fatty acid ester), D-sorbite and acid anhydrides thereof, and aliphatic acid commonly used is that saturated acid or unsaturated acids, the carbon number of C11, C12 is that aliphatic acid more than 24 also can use.In general, the ester initial stage good antifogging effect of medium chain fatty acid; The lasting good antifogging effect of the fat of LCFA.In fact the antifoggant mixed ester of multiple acid often, the fatty acid ester of many polyalcohols lacks hydrophily, through the oxirane addition, can improve hydrophily, antifog property of increase initial stage and the antifog property of low temperature.
Antifoggant can adopt glycerin mono-fatty acid ester, sorbitan monopalmitate, sorbitan monostearate or PEO (20) glyceryl monostearate.
Pre-coating film with preventing atomization function of the present invention does not haze, mist degree (%) :≤0.3, have anti-fog function.
